DNS Flag Day Policy Drivers and Technical Motivations
- by Staff
DNS Flag Day represents a pivotal initiative in the evolution of the Domain Name System (DNS), aimed at improving its efficiency, security, and interoperability. First introduced in 2019, DNS Flag Day is not an official holiday but a collaborative effort driven by key players in the DNS ecosystem, including software vendors, service providers, and standards bodies. The initiative seeks to address long-standing inefficiencies and technical debt within the DNS by encouraging the adoption of modern standards and deprecating outdated practices. Understanding the policy drivers and technical motivations behind DNS Flag Day sheds light on its critical role in shaping the future of DNS governance and functionality.
The DNS is a cornerstone of the internet, enabling the translation of human-readable domain names into numerical IP addresses. Despite its foundational importance, the DNS has evolved in a piecemeal manner since its inception in the 1980s, leading to inconsistencies and inefficiencies in its implementation. Over time, backward compatibility with outdated systems has become a significant obstacle to adopting new and improved standards. DNS Flag Day emerged as a policy-driven initiative to overcome these challenges, creating a coordinated push for modernization.
A primary driver of DNS Flag Day is the need to enforce compliance with established DNS standards. Many DNS implementations historically relied on workarounds to accommodate non-compliant servers or configurations. These workarounds introduced inefficiencies, increased the complexity of DNS software, and created potential security vulnerabilities. DNS Flag Day initiatives seek to eliminate these legacy dependencies by encouraging operators to update their systems to adhere strictly to the relevant standards outlined by organizations such as the Internet Engineering Task Force (IETF). This policy goal aligns with broader efforts to promote a secure and reliable internet.
One of the key technical motivations for DNS Flag Day is the resolution of issues related to the Extension Mechanisms for DNS (EDNS). EDNS, introduced in 1999, expanded the capabilities of the DNS by allowing larger message sizes and supporting new features such as DNS Security Extensions (DNSSEC). However, many legacy DNS servers and middleware devices were either improperly configured or failed to support EDNS altogether, leading to communication failures or degraded performance. By setting a deadline for compliance with EDNS, DNS Flag Day initiatives aim to ensure that only standards-compliant systems participate in the global DNS, thereby improving interoperability and performance.
DNS Flag Day also addresses the growing demands on DNS infrastructure due to the proliferation of internet-connected devices and services. The increased volume of DNS queries, coupled with the need for low-latency resolution, necessitates an optimized and streamlined DNS ecosystem. By deprecating outdated practices and promoting adherence to modern standards, DNS Flag Day initiatives reduce unnecessary overhead, enabling DNS systems to operate more efficiently and handle growing workloads.
Another important technical motivation is enhancing DNS security. The DNS is a frequent target for cyberattacks, including cache poisoning, Distributed Denial of Service (DDoS) attacks, and DNS hijacking. Legacy practices and non-compliant configurations exacerbate these vulnerabilities, leaving DNS systems susceptible to exploitation. DNS Flag Day initiatives promote the adoption of secure protocols such as DNSSEC, which authenticates DNS responses, and encrypted DNS protocols like DNS over HTTPS (DoH) and DNS over TLS (DoT), which protect query confidentiality. These measures strengthen the overall security of the DNS and reduce the risk of attacks.
The policy drivers of DNS Flag Day also reflect the importance of fostering collaboration and accountability among stakeholders. The DNS is a decentralized system with no single governing authority, making coordinated action essential for addressing systemic issues. DNS Flag Day initiatives rely on consensus among software developers, network operators, and DNS administrators to implement changes on a global scale. This collaborative approach ensures that improvements are implemented uniformly, benefiting the entire DNS ecosystem.
Despite its benefits, DNS Flag Day initiatives face challenges related to adoption and awareness. Many operators, particularly those with limited resources or technical expertise, may struggle to update their systems to meet compliance requirements. To address this, DNS Flag Day initiatives emphasize outreach, education, and support, providing tools and guidance to help operators modernize their configurations. The initiative also underscores the importance of testing and validation, encouraging operators to verify their systems’ compliance ahead of each DNS Flag Day deadline.
The impact of DNS Flag Day extends beyond the technical realm, influencing broader internet governance and policy discussions. By demonstrating the effectiveness of coordinated action in the DNS ecosystem, DNS Flag Day serves as a model for addressing other challenges in internet infrastructure. It highlights the value of multistakeholder collaboration, transparency, and a commitment to standards-based development in fostering a resilient and secure internet.
In conclusion, DNS Flag Day represents a critical step toward modernizing the DNS and addressing long-standing inefficiencies and vulnerabilities. Its policy drivers emphasize the need for compliance, collaboration, and accountability, while its technical motivations focus on improving performance, security, and interoperability. By aligning the efforts of diverse stakeholders, DNS Flag Day ensures that the DNS remains a robust and reliable foundation for the global internet. As the digital landscape continues to evolve, initiatives like DNS Flag Day will play an essential role in shaping the future of DNS policy and governance.
DNS Flag Day represents a pivotal initiative in the evolution of the Domain Name System (DNS), aimed at improving its efficiency, security, and interoperability. First introduced in 2019, DNS Flag Day is not an official holiday but a collaborative effort driven by key players in the DNS ecosystem, including software vendors, service providers, and standards…